- java.lang.Object
-
- com.sun.tools.xjc.model.SymbolSpace
-
public class SymbolSpace extends Object
Symbol space for ID/IDREF. In XJC, the whole ID space is considered to be splitted into one or more "symbol space". For an IDREF to match an ID, we impose additional restriction to the one stated in the XML rec.That is, XJC'll require that the IDREF belongs to the same symbol space as the ID. Having this concept allows us to assign more specific type to IDREF.
See the design document for detail.
- Author:
- Kohsuke KAWAGUCHI
-
-
Constructor Summary
Constructors Constructor Description SymbolSpace(JCodeModel _codeModel)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description JType
getType()
Gets the Java type of this symbol space.void
setType(JType _type)
String
toString()
-
-
-
Constructor Detail
-
SymbolSpace
public SymbolSpace(JCodeModel _codeModel)
-
-